Production Figures: 23,167. The lowest production year was 1957, which is also the most sought after in a case of basic supply-and-demand economics at work and play. Watch Out For: leaky, ill fitting tailgate; rust, especially in tire well Nomad Clubs Chevrolet Nomad Association, www.chevynomadclub.com Los Angeles Classic Chevy Club, www.laccc.com

Produced from 1955-57, the Chevy Bel Air Nomad has chrome tailgate bars, a ribbed roof and slanted "B" pillars. Many of its characteristics are similar to modern day hatchbacks. Just as we do now, the front seat folds forward to crawl into the car. The bench back seat folds down to accommodate cargo. The two piece tailgate has a glass.

1957 Chevrolet Nomad. Nomad was the special and sporty Chevrolet 2-door sports station wagon, with 1957 as its last and final build in a three year run. The name Nomad continued but as a 4-door model from 1958 on and sold far better than in 2-door style. All 2-door style tri-five Nomads are very collectible today and are especially highly.

The Chevy Nomad shares remarkably little with the rest of the 1955-57 Chevy passenger-car line. Here's what makes it special. The story of the Chevrolet Nomad rightly begins with a show car that made its debut at the General Motors Motorama at the Waldorf Astoria on January 26, 1954.

Redesigned body - Featuring Chevrolet's new signature bumper design and hooded headlights.The 1957 Nomad had more prominent wheel arches and an even lower roofline than previous years. New engine options - The standard engine remained the 265 cubic inch V8, but buyers could opt for a 283 cubic inch engine producing either 220 or 270 horsepower.

1957: A Legacy of Automotive Innovation. The real game changer for the Nomad was 1957. Despite being the second-most expensive car in the lineup, the Nomad sold well in both 1955 and 1956 with around 8,000 units sold each of the two years. In 1957, Chevrolet added larger engines, new styling details, and for the first time, a 283 cubic inch.

The 1955-1957 Nomad was a one-of-a-kind car, because it was completely different than than other wagons of it's time. The roof line and two-door body style was a cross between a sedan and a sport coupe. At that time, two-door hardtop had no post (side door-window surrounding framework), where the sedan did.
